The Auchentoshan Distillery was first established in 1823 and is situated on the outskirts of Glasgow in Clydebank. The distillery sits on the Lowlands whisky region of Scotland and boats as being ‘the breakfast whisky’ of the industry. This is due to its sweet and delicate flavours. The word Auchentoshan is taken from the Gaelic word Achadh an Oisein meaning “corner of the field”. The distillery is known for its triple distillation methods which are usually used in Ireland to make whiskey.
